    /**
     * Migrates object literal providers which do not use "useValue", "useClass",
     * "useExisting" or "useFactory". These providers behave differently in Ivy. e.g.
     *
     * ```ts
     *   {provide: X} -> {provide: X, useValue: undefined} // this is how it behaves in VE
     *   {provide: X} -> {provide: X, useClass: X} // this is how it behaves in Ivy
     * ```
     *
     * To ensure forward compatibility, we migrate these empty object literal providers
     * to explicitly use `useValue: undefined`.
     */
    private _migrateLiteralProviders;
